If you’ve been craving a flavorful, satisfying dish that comes together quickly and packs a punch, this Easy Chinese Pepper Steak Recipe is going to steal your heart. The tender slices of beef marry beautifully with crisp bell peppers and a luscious sauce that hits all the right notes—umami, sweet, and just a hint of spice. Whether you’re cooking for your family or impressing friends, this recipe is a straightforward way to bring authentic Chinese-inspired flavors into your kitchen without any fuss.

Ingredients You’ll Need
Keeping things simple but delicious is the secret to this recipe’s success. Each ingredient plays a special role—from the tender steak that forms the hearty base to the colorful bell peppers that add crunch and vibrancy. Together, they create a balanced texture and irresistible aroma.
- 1 lb flank steak or sirloin, thinly sliced: Choose a tender cut and slice it thinly for quick cooking and maximum flavor absorption.
- 2 tbsp soy sauce: This adds salty, savory depth to the beef marinade and the sauce.
- 1 tbsp cornstarch: Helps tenderize the meat and creates a beautifully silky sauce consistency.
- 1 red bell pepper, sliced: Brings sweet crunch and a vibrant pop of color to the dish.
- 1 green bell pepper, sliced: Adds a fresh, slightly bitter contrast to the red pepper’s sweetness.
- 1 small onion, sliced: Offers natural sweetness and layers of flavor when stir-fried.
- 3 cloves garlic, minced: Infuses a robust, aromatic punch essential to Chinese cooking.
- 1 tsp fresh ginger, grated: Adds a warm, zesty brightness that lifts the whole dish.
- 2 tbsp vegetable oil: Neutral-flavored oil perfect for high-heat stir-frying.
- 3 tbsp soy sauce: A second dose in the sauce to boost the umami factor.
- 2 tbsp oyster sauce: Brings a rich, slightly sweet depth that defines classic pepper steak.
- 1/4 cup water: Helps create a saucy, juicy coating for the meat and veggies.
- 1 tsp sugar: Balances savory flavors with just a touch of sweetness.
- 1 tsp sesame oil: Drizzled in at the end for a nutty aroma and authentic finishing touch.
- 1/2 tsp black pepper: Packs the peppery heat that the dish is named for.
How to Make Easy Chinese Pepper Steak Recipe
Step 1: Marinate the Beef
Start by combining the thinly sliced beef with soy sauce and cornstarch in a bowl. This simple marinade not only tenderizes the meat but also forms the base of a silky sauce later on. Let the beef rest for about 10 to 15 minutes while you prep your vegetables—that way, all the flavors get to mingle and intensify beautifully.
Step 2: Cook the Vegetables
Heat 1 tablespoon of vegetable oil over medium-high heat in a large skillet or wok. Toss in the sliced bell peppers and onions, stir-frying for about 3 to 4 minutes until they become slightly tender but still retain their lovely crunch. Then set them aside for now; they’ll reunite with the beef shortly for that perfect harmony of textures.
Step 3: Cook the Beef
Add the remaining tablespoon of oil to the hot pan. Stir-fry the marinated beef quickly for 2 to 3 minutes until it browns nicely, locking in those meaty juices. Then toss in the minced garlic and freshly grated ginger for an extra burst of flavor, cooking for roughly 30 seconds until your kitchen fills with a mouthwatering fragrance.
Step 4: Combine & Finish
Return the cooked vegetables to the pan. Now pour in the soy sauce, oyster sauce, water, sugar, sesame oil, and black pepper. Stir everything together and cook for another 1 to 2 minutes, making sure the beef and vegetables are beautifully coated in the savory sauce. That’s the magic moment where it all comes together—a quick toss and your Easy Chinese Pepper Steak Recipe is ready!
How to Serve Easy Chinese Pepper Steak Recipe

Garnishes
For a bright, fresh finish, sprinkle some chopped green onions or toasted sesame seeds on top. These add a subtle crunch and boost visual appeal, making each bite even more delightful. A handful of fresh cilantro can also add a lovely herbal freshness to contrast the rich sauce.
Side Dishes
This pepper steak shines best when served over fluffy steamed rice or your favorite noodles, soaking up every bit of that delicious sauce. You can opt for jasmine rice for a fragrant pairing or even try brown rice for a hearty twist. A side of steamed broccoli or snap peas can add extra green crunch and keep things balanced.
Creative Ways to Present
Looking to impress your guests? Serve the pepper steak in individual bowls alongside small dipping bowls of extra soy or chili oil. Or transform it into a vibrant lettuce wrap by scooping up a portion wrapped in crisp lettuce leaves for a fun, hands-on experience. It’s a beautiful way to present this classic with a fresh spin.
Make Ahead and Storage
Storing Leftovers
Leftover Easy Chinese Pepper Steak Recipe keeps beautifully in an airtight container in the refrigerator for up to three days. The flavors continue to deepen, making it perfect for a quick lunch or dinner when you need a fast but satisfying bite.
Freezing
If you want to stash some away for later, this dish freezes well. Place it in a freezer-safe container and freeze for up to two months. Just be mindful that the texture of the bell peppers may soften slightly after thawing, but the flavor remains delicious.
Reheating
To reheat, gently warm your pepper steak in a skillet over medium heat, adding a splash of water or broth to revive the sauce’s moisture. This method helps preserve the tender texture of the beef and ensures your Easy Chinese Pepper Steak Recipe tastes just as amazing the second time around.
FAQs
Can I use other cuts of beef for this recipe?
Absolutely! While flank steak or sirloin is best for quick cooking and tenderness, you can also try skirt steak or top round. Just ensure you slice the beef thinly against the grain to keep it tender.
Is there a vegetarian alternative for this dish?
Yes! Swap the beef for firm tofu, tempeh, or even portobello mushrooms. Marinate and cook them similarly, and you’ll enjoy the same vibrant flavors with a plant-based twist.
What can I substitute for oyster sauce?
If you don’t have oyster sauce on hand, try using hoisin sauce or a mixture of soy sauce and a touch of sugar for sweetness. Keep in mind that oyster sauce has a unique umami note that enriches the dish wonderfully.
Can I make this recipe spicier?
Definitely! Add sliced fresh chili peppers or a dash of chili garlic sauce while cooking for an exciting kick that complements the black pepper’s warmth.
How long does marinating the beef improve the dish?
Letting the beef marinate for at least 10 to 15 minutes makes a noticeable difference in tenderness and flavor. If you have time, marinating for up to 30 minutes in the fridge can intensify the taste even more.
Final Thoughts
There’s something so rewarding about creating a restaurant-quality dish at home that everyone loves, and this Easy Chinese Pepper Steak Recipe does exactly that without any stress. It’s quick, packed with flavor, and wonderfully adaptable for any occasion. I hope you have as much fun making and savoring this as I do every time—it just might become your new go-to weeknight dinner!
Print
Easy Chinese Pepper Steak Recipe
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: 4 servings
- Category: Main Dish
- Method: Stovetop
- Cuisine: Chinese
Description
This Easy Chinese Pepper Steak recipe features tender slices of flank steak stir-fried with colorful bell peppers and onions in a savory soy and oyster sauce. Ready in just 30 minutes, it’s a quick and flavorful dinner that pairs perfectly with steamed rice or noodles for a classic Chinese-inspired meal.
Ingredients
Beef Marinade
- 1 lb flank steak or sirloin, thinly sliced
- 2 tbsp soy sauce
- 1 tbsp cornstarch
Vegetables
- 1 red bell pepper, sliced
- 1 green bell pepper, sliced
- 1 small onion, sliced
- 3 cloves garlic, minced
- 1 tsp fresh ginger, grated
Sauces & Oils
- 2 tbsp vegetable oil
- 3 tbsp soy sauce
- 2 tbsp oyster sauce
- 1/4 cup water
- 1 tsp sugar
- 1 tsp sesame oil
- 1/2 tsp black pepper
Instructions
- Marinate the Beef: In a bowl, combine the thinly sliced flank steak with 2 tablespoons of soy sauce and 1 tablespoon of cornstarch. Mix well to coat the beef evenly and let it marinate for 10-15 minutes to tenderize and absorb the flavors while you prepare the vegetables.
- Prepare the Vegetables: Slice the red and green bell peppers and the small onion. Mince the garlic and grate the fresh ginger to have everything ready for stir-frying.
- Cook the Vegetables: Heat 1 tablespoon of vegetable oil in a large skillet or wok over medium-high heat. Add the sliced bell peppers and onions, stir-frying them for 3-4 minutes until they soften slightly but remain crisp. Remove the vegetables from the pan and set them aside.
- Cook the Beef: Add the remaining 1 tablespoon of vegetable oil to the pan. Stir-fry the marinated beef for 2-3 minutes until it turns browned and cooked through. Add the minced garlic and grated ginger to the pan, cooking for another 30 seconds until they release their aroma.
- Combine & Serve: Return the cooked vegetables to the pan with the beef. Stir in 3 tablespoons soy sauce, 2 tablespoons oyster sauce, 1/4 cup water, 1 teaspoon sugar, 1 teaspoon sesame oil, and 1/2 teaspoon black pepper. Stir-fry everything together for 1-2 minutes until the sauce coats all the ingredients evenly. Serve hot over steamed rice or noodles for a complete meal.
Notes
- For a gluten-free option, use tamari or gluten-free soy sauce and ensure the oyster sauce is gluten-free.
- Flank steak is preferred for its tenderness and flavor, but sirloin works well too.
- Adjust the amount of black pepper to your taste for spiciness.
- For extra flavor, garnish with chopped green onions or toasted sesame seeds.
- The dish cooks quickly, so prepare all ingredients before starting to stir-fry.

